A lawyer who handles car accidents could work on a contingent fee basis in a variety of cases. This means that they will only be paid if they obtain compensation for you, whether through a settlement or a court verdict. Your lawyer's interest will be in alignment with those of you and he or she will do everything to get the maximum amount for your case.

New York law defines aggressive driving as "any act by a motor vehicle operator that puts at risk the lives or property of someone else." This includes driving too closely or racing, as well as tailgating. It also includes actions such as gestures, frustrated facial expressions and hand signals. The dangers of aggressive driving are that it can and cause serious injuries to pedestrians as well as other drivers.
